LEVY, Judge.
Cesar Rodriguez, the husband, and Barbara Rodriguez, the wife, were divorced in 1986. By September of 1993, the husband had accumulated child support arrearages of $33,800, and the wife moved the trial court to hold the husband in contempt. After an evidentiary hearing, the trial court concluded that the husband had wilfully refused to pay his child support obligations, and found him to be in contempt of court.
